#ce0453 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ce0453 is composed of 80.8% red, 1.6%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 336.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.2%. #ce0453 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08a6 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#ce0453 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ce0453 has RGB values of R:206, G:4,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.6,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13501523.

Shades and Tints of #ce0453
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0005 is the darkest color, while #fff9fc is the lightest one.
